Concerns have been raised regarding the reliability of transactions on ChefSuccess, particularly experiences of not receiving purchased items. One user reported sending a money order for items, only to find the seller's email was invalid and their account no longer accepting messages, despite the seller continuing to post. Recommendations included contacting the platform's administrator for assistance and utilizing PayPal for added buyer protection, as it provides recourse in disputes. Other users shared similar experiences, emphasizing the importance of using secure payment methods and the potential for sellers to be unresponsive or dishonest. Suggestions for improving the platform included implementing a feedback system akin to eBay's to enhance trust among users. Despite these issues, many participants reported positive experiences, highlighting that such problems are not common but do occur. Overall, the thread reflects a mix of caution and optimism regarding buying and selling on ChefSuccess, with an emphasis on the necessity for communication and secure transactions.

I had a bad experience on Lets Make A Deal with someone who insisted I pay by check and then said the package got damaged en route and all she got back was the empty envelope, blah blah...I was out over $30 and got nothing. Since I paid with a check I had no recourse. So now I only deal in Paypal.

Frequently Asked Questions

What should I do if I never received my Pampered Chef order?

If you have not received your Pampered Chef order, the first step is to check your order confirmation email for tracking information. If the tracking shows that the item was delivered but you did not receive it, contact your local postal service. If you still need assistance, reach out to Pampered Chef customer service for further help.

How can I contact Pampered Chef customer service about missing items?

You can contact Pampered Chef customer service by visiting their official website and navigating to the 'Contact Us' section. There, you can find options to chat online, send an email, or call their support line for assistance regarding your missing items.

What information do I need to provide when reporting a missing order?

When reporting a missing order, be prepared to provide your order number, the date of purchase, your shipping address, and any tracking information you have. This will help customer service quickly locate your order and assist you more effectively.

Will I be refunded if my order is confirmed as lost?

If your order is confirmed as lost after investigation, Pampered Chef typically offers a replacement or a full refund. The specific resolution may depend on the circumstances, so it’s best to discuss your options with customer service.

How long does it take to resolve issues with missing items?

The time it takes to resolve issues with missing items can vary. Generally, Pampered Chef aims to address such concerns within a few business days. However, if the issue requires further investigation, it may take longer. Stay in contact with customer service for updates on your case.
